Short-Run Supply Curve
A graphical representation showing the quantity of goods a firm is willing and able to supply at different prices in a given short-term period, holding some factors constant.
Marginal Cost Curve
A graph that displays how the expense of producing one additional unit of a good changes as production volume varies.
Average Variable Cost
The variable cost per unit of output.
Short-Run Marginal Cost
The cost incurred by producing one more unit of a product or service in the short term, where some inputs are fixed.
